ts-caddyfile
Version:
CaddyFile Parser and generator VERY WIP
9 lines (8 loc) • 341 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
const TLSCoreExtract = /(?!\stls)\s(?<certificate>\S+)\s(?<key>\S+)(?<!{)/;
function ProcessTLSDirective(directive) {
const core = TLSCoreExtract.exec(directive).groups;
return { type: 'tls', ...core };
}
exports.ProcessTLSDirective = ProcessTLSDirective;